Job description

JOB SUMMARY: To perform exams in the Radiology Department, as ordered by the attending physician. This may include X-rays, CT, and/or EKG exams. Technologist must also alternate night and weekend call with other technologists unless other arrangements have been made.
QUALIFICATIONS:
Must be a graduate of an accredited Radiology School


Must be registered as a current member of the ARRT, or registry eligible.
Excellent communication, interpersonal, and patient service skills.
Good analytical and problem-solving skills.
JOB REQUIREMENTS:
Safeguarding the privacy and security of protected health information (PHI) in any form including electronic, written, or verbal.
Professional attitude, leadership role and team member abilities. Maintain a positive professional role throughout the facility and community.
Familiarizes self with and adheres to all facility and department safety policies and procedures.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
Performing the day-to-day exams of the Radiology Department

This includes X-ray, CT, and EKG exams.
To be knowledgeable and proficient in the areas of x-ray, CT and EKG exams.
If additional training is necessary, technologist must be willing to attend educational classes and/or training within the area of need. This includes the need for additional training due to advanced technology in the Radiology fields to keep current in the medical field.
Promote and maintain a professional, efficient, productive, and friendly atmosphere for patients, co-workers, and physicians.
Maintain diagnostic imaging equipment and materials.
Positioning patients for diagnostic imaging examinations
Advising and supporting patients


Following physician order to ensure accuracy of image capture.
Shielding patients from unnecessary exposure to X-rays or radiation.
Perform other related duties as assigned.
TYPICAL WORKING CONDITIONS: The work area is mainly in the Radiology Department, but may include Acute Care, Long Term Nursing Care, Emergency Room, Surgery, and Clinic. Age of patients varies from neonates to geriatrics

The department is staffed 10 hours per day with on-call after regular hours during the week and/or weekends.
